... Read moreTaking time for simple self-care can truly uplift your mood and mental well-being. On my recent self-care day, I focused on unwinding with quiet moments and treating myself to a gentle nail care session. Using calming scents like amber and floral perfumes, such as Victoria's Secret Amber Rommel Paris, enhanced the soothing atmosphere. I found that setting aside an hour for a moisturizing shower, followed by carefully painting my nails, helped me slow down and appreciate the little things. This small ritual is my way of showing self-love, reminding me that taking care of myself is not only about appearance but about feeling nurtured and valued. Integrating a self-care routine like this into your weekly schedule doesn’t require fancy products or extensive time. Even simple actions—like lighting your favorite scented candle, using nourishing hand cream, or enjoying a peaceful bath—can make a considerable difference. These practices help reduce stress, promote relaxation, and boost confidence. Remember to create a calming environment that inspires you. Play soft music, dim the lights, and allow yourself to be fully present. Self-care is a personal journey, and it feels wonderful to carve out moments just for yourself amidst busy days. Whether it’s a nail day, a skincare routine, or just a quiet moment of reflection, these simple steps cultivate a stronger connection to your inner peace and happiness.
